Output d5eb0817dea981c850547596400db6dc504e154a675365836a87eaf8e2d3bdea:1

value
569406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c6daee1c190da99d297e6daa69dd5784132de37 OP_EQUAL
address
3JsLMXS4D8GV5wypjq9oYaxrr4dxc79Cno
transaction
d5eb0817dea981c850547596400db6dc504e154a675365836a87eaf8e2d3bdea
spent
true